The African Media Network for Health and Environmental Promotion (REMAPSEN) has condemned the recent killing events in the Democratic Republic of Congo (DRC).
The President REMAPSEN, Bamba Youssouf in a statement made available to Journalists at its Nigeria office, said the event is causing heavy losses of human life.
“For several weeks, African news has been marked mainly by the clashes in eastern Democratic Republic of Congo, causing heavy losses of human life.”
He said the organisation remains strongly attached to life and cannot ignore the hundreds of deaths and thousands of injuries in the DRC, consequences of this barbarity.
“REMAPSEN condemns these killings and supports the valiant people of the DRC, one of the most productive countries of REMAPSEN.
“We have a special thought for all our colleagues from the DRC who are members of REMAPSEN, whether at the central, regional or national levels.” The statement reads in part.
He however prayed for a rapid and definitive return of peace in all parts of the country.
